    Abstract:

    We analyzed the characteristics of volatile organic compounds (VOCs) and their key active components in Jiangsu province using the VOCs data monitored in urban areas of Jiangsu's 13 cities from August 13th to September 30th,2019.The results showed that the daily concentration of VOCs in Jiangsu ranged from 8.83×10-9 to 45.11×10-9,with alkanes being dominant and followed by aromatics,alkenes,and alkynes.The concentration of VOCs in 13 cities ranged from 7.85×10-9 to 30.52×10-9,which was highest in Xuzhou due to the location of its monitoring station as well as its industrial structure.When the ambient ozone concentration was excellent,good,light pollution,and moderate pollution,the total VOCs were 14.96×10-9,17.96×10-9,25.85×10-9,and 25.11×10-9,respectively.On the whole,the VOCs concentration was higher when the ozone was in pollution level,and the proportion of alkyne in VOCs increased with the aggravation of ozone pollution,indicating the close relation between ozone generation and human activities.Species including m/p-xylene,ethylene,toluene,propylene,isoprene and o-xylene,were screened out by weighting,which were the key species that had large and extensive impact on ambient VOCs of Jiangsu province.
